Job Description

We are seeking a highly detail-oriented and versatile Financial Operations & Expense Accountant  to manage and optimize company-wide financial functions related to expense auditing, procurement, self-funding benefits, and budgeting. This role serves as a cross-functional link between Corporate Accounting, HR, Procurement, and Administration, ensuring policy compliance, financial accuracy, cost control, and process efficiency. The ideal candidate will bring expertise in auditing, procurement, financial reporting, and benefits accounting, with a drive to support continuous improvement in financial operations.

Summary of Job Functions

Expense Auditing & Financial Reporting

  • Review and audit employee expense reports and corporate credit card transactions for compliance and accuracy
  • Ensure appropriate approvals, documentation, and GL coding for all expense-related activities
  • Enter and reconcile expenses and credit card transactions in the accounting system
  • Support month-end closing with reconciliations and reports for expense-related accounts

Budget Oversight & Procurement Management

  • Partner with Recruiting and Admin teams to track and manage budgets for career fairs, intern programs, events, and merchandise
  • Monitor expenses, perform cost-benefit analysis, and generate reports for leadership
  • Manage procurement and inventory of office merchandise, furniture, and supplies
  • Negotiate vendor contracts and pricing, ensuring alignment with financial controls and company policies

Benefits Self-Funding & Claims Accounting

  • Reconcile self-funded employee benefits program transactions, including claims, contributions, and reserves
  • Prepare and analyze financial reports for benefits costs and forecasts
  • Collaborate with HR and benefits providers to assess plan performance and identify cost optimization opportunities
  • Ensure compliance with regulatory guidelines and support internal/external audits

Process Improvement, Documentation & Compliance

  • Identify opportunities to streamline financial workflows across expense management, procurement, and benefits accounting
  • Develop and maintain comprehensive documentation of financial procedures
  • Educate internal stakeholders on policies, procedures, and compliance requirements related to spending and benefits
  • Act as a liaison between Corporate Accounting, HR, and external vendors to ensure operational alignment

Minimum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, Business Administration, or a related field
  • 3+ years of progressive experience in one or more of the following: expense auditing, procurement, benefits accounting, or financial analysis
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and financial systems such as Concur, Sage Intacct, QuickBooks, or similar platforms
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a high attention to detail
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ills for cross-departmental collaboration
  • Ability to work independently, multitask, and meet deadlines in a dynamic environment
  • Ability to work onsite in our Jupiter, FL office

Preferred Skills and Previous Experience:

  • Proficiency in SQL and Excel automation for financial data analysis
  • Background in vendor negotiations, procurement management, and inventory tracking
  • Experience with self-funded benefits programs, healthcare claims, or insurance finance
  • Familiarity with HRIS systems, benefits administration tools, or inventory management systems
  • Knowledge of GAAP and audit procedures

Voloridge Investment Management is an SEC registered investment advisor. A private investment company founded in 2009, our mission is to deliver superior risk-adjusted returns for qualified investors, using advanced proprietary modeling technology, conservative investment tactics and sophisticated risk management. Our market neutral equities strategy takes both long and short positions in the most actively traded equities and is designed to capture alpha while limiting exposure to directional markets risks. Our futures strategy takes both long and short positions in the most actively traded global futures and is also built to maximize alpha captured across all futures markets traded while capping exposure to any sector at a given time.
